Why Golden Hour is the Best Time for Wedding Photos
When it comes to wedding photography, timing is everything. One of the most magical and flattering times to capture your love story is during golden hour—the hour just after sunrise or before sunset. As a San Diego wedding photographer, I always encourage couples to take advantage of this stunning natural light. Here’s why golden hour is the best time for your wedding photos:
1. Soft, Romantic Lighting
Golden hour provides warm, diffused light that creates a soft and dreamy glow. Unlike midday sun, which can be harsh and create unwanted shadows, golden hour light is gentle on the skin and enhances natural beauty. This soft illumination helps to highlight emotions, details, and the intimate moments shared between you and your partner.
2. No Harsh Shadows or Squinting
Midday sun can be intense and unflattering, causing squinting and harsh contrasts in your images. Golden hour eliminates this issue, giving your photos a flawless, even exposure. Your wedding portraits will feel more natural, relaxed, and visually stunning without the distraction of extreme shadows or bright highlights.
